# Break-Glass Access: Telemetry Compression Service

If the Quillbend compressor stalls and payloads back up past the Hathredge queue limit, reviewers may invoke break-glass access to restart the zstd worker pool directly. Document the incident ticket first, verify the dictionary version matches the deployed schema, and confirm the on-call lead has acknowledged. The emergency vault unlocks with the passphrase below.

strongbox words: zorwyn-sorael-belion-ulaius-silmir-ulays-briax-rusdor-gorix

Subject: Tollgrim billing worker — blue-green cut-over complete

Team,

Cut-over finished last night. Green fleet now takes all billing traffic; blue stays warm for 72 hours, then drains. Plugin authors: your hooks now run against the green API surface only, so retire any blue-specific shims. Retry semantics are unchanged; batch windows are slightly shorter. No action needed unless alerts fire. For reference, the active green-fleet configuration values are shown below.

— Oren

settings of taguf-fajef:
[eliath]
team = julir
access_code = ac_78465c
host = eliath.lumicgrid.local
port = 8443
owner = feniel.wenir
peer = quenmir.tolvaqsys.local

## 14:22 — Root cause isolated

Uploads from the Marrowfield tenant failed because the encoding sniffer in TextGate defaulted to Latin-1 on short files. Fix: require BOM check before heuristic fallback; added regression fixtures for 12-byte UTF-8 samples. Deployed to staging at 14:40, prod at 15:05. The fix landed in the build identified below.

session token of tajef-bageg = htk21_5d90d574934f3ccae6437

The Marrowmap tile-rendering cache layer is serving stale tiles for the Velden region following yesterday's reprojection job. The invalidation sweep completed per logs, but edge nodes still return pre-reprojection tiles, suggesting the purge manifest missed the secondary key namespace. Proposed fix: regenerate the manifest with namespace expansion enabled and re-run the purge during the low-traffic window. This touches shared cache infrastructure, so it cannot ship without sign-off. Sign-off is required from the following owner.

account owner for bawip-tahag: Raleth Quenok